This is a hands-on position assisting with every aspect of craft spirit production, bottling, warehousing, and maintaining our distillery.
Responsibilities
- Assist with mashing, fermenting, distilling, and proofing spirits.
- Fill, label, cork, and package bottles.
- Prepare barrels for filling and assist with barrel aging operations.
- Clean and sanitize fermentation tanks, stills, hoses, pumps, and production equipment.
- Move grain, barrels, cases, and other materials throughout the facility.
- Maintain production records and inventory.
- Help prepare customer orders and deliveries.
- Assist in developing new whiskey products and experimental batches.
- Keep the distillery clean, organized, and operating efficiently.
- Support tasting room operations when needed.
